简单
技术面试0 次浏览

请简要介绍一下软件测试的主要流程。

测试工程师
软件测试测试流程

答题要点

软件测试的主要流程通常包含以下几个关键阶段。首先是测试计划阶段,在此阶段要明确测试的目标、范围、方法、进度安排等内容,制定详细的测试计划,为后续测试工作提供指导。接着是测试设计阶段,依据需求规格说明书等文档,设计测试用例,确定测试数据和预期结果。然后进入测试执行阶段,按照设计好的测试用例执行测试,记录测试过程中发现的问题,生成测试报告。在测试执行过程中,需要及时与开发团队沟通,反馈问题。最后是测试评估阶段,对测试结果进行分析和总结,评估软件是否达到了预期的质量标准,判断是否可以发布。如果存在未解决的问题,需要与相关人员讨论解决方案,确定是否需要进行回归测试。此外,在整个测试流程中,还需要对测试用例进行维护和更新,以保证测试的有效性和完整性。